    • PROBLEM TO BE SOLVED: To provide a liquid crystal display panel assembly that can reduce the number of driving circuit chips and the production cost of a display device, and improve the picture quality of a display device and decrease in the aperture ratio of pixels, and a display device. SOLUTION: The display panel assembly includes a plurality pixels arranged in a matrix and each having a pixel electrode and a switching element connected to the pixel electrode, a plurality of pairs of gate lines connected to the switching elements and extending in the row direction, and a plurality of data lines connected to the switching elements and extending in the column direction; wherein the pair of gate lines are connected to the switching elements in one pixel row, while one data line is connected to the switching elements in at least two pixel columns, and each data line is bent in a lateral direction between two adjacent gate lines.     • PROBLEM TO BE SOLVED: To provide a drive circuit for a display device which is highly reliable, even with respect to a long-period drive. SOLUTION: To provide a drive circuit for a display device which is highly reliable, even for the long-period drive. The drive circuit for a display device has a plurality of stages which are mutually connected and respectively generate an output signal sequentially. Each stage has a plurality of transistors, and each transistor comprises a control electrode, a first insulating film formed on the control electrode, a semiconductor layer formed on the first insulating film, an input electrode at least a part of which is formed on the semiconductor layer, an output electrode, at least a part of which is formed on the semiconductor layer, and a second insulating film formed on the input electrode and output electrodes, wherein the ratio of the thickness of the semiconductor layer to that of the first insulating film is 0.3 to 1.5.     • PROBLEM TO BE SOLVED: To simplify a method of manufacturing a liquid crystal array panel to easily form color filters. SOLUTION: The thin film transistor array panel includes a substrate, a gate line extending in a first direction on the substrate, a data line extending in a second direction on the substrate and intersecting the gate line and insulated from the gate line, a thin film transistor including a control terminal connected to the gate line, an input terminal connected to the data line and an output terminal, a plurality of color filters formed on the thin film transistor, a light blocking member formed on the thin film transistor, defining the space for storing the color filters, and including an output terminal protection portion surrounding at least the region of the output terminal of the thin film transistor, and a pixel electrode formed on the light blocking member and the color filters and coming in contact with the region of the output terminal surrounded by the output terminal protection portion of the light blocking member.     • PROBLEM TO BE SOLVED: To provide a thin film transistor display plate wherein a switching defect can be prevented. SOLUTION: In the thin film transistor display plate, gate lines having gate electrodes are formed on an insulating substrate and semiconductor layers overlapping with the gate electrodes are formed at an upper part of a gate insulating film covering the gate lines. Data lines crossing the gate lines and having source electrodes and drain electrodes separated from the data lines are formed at the upper part of the gate insulating film and conductor bodies for shielding light are formed to be parallel to the data lines in same layer as the data lines and the drain electrodes. A protective film having contact holes each exposing a portion of the drain electrode and consisting of an organic insulating substance is formed thereon and pixel electrodes connected to the drain electrodes through the contact holes are formed at an upper part of the protective film. At this time, each data line is perfectly superposed on one of the pixel electrodes in pixel regions adjacent to each other. COPYRIGHT: (C)2005,JPO&NCIPI
